Memorandum by The RED Initiative, De Montfort
University
SUMMARY
1. This submission discusses the various
needs and requirements of product-, commercial interior- and industrial
design consultancies in developing their practice of eco-design.
2. The evidence focuses on the existing
business practise of small UK design consultancies with regard
to sustainability, and highlights current industry opinions about
legislation, levels of eco-design implementation, and the barriers
cited of why eco-design strategies are not currently integral
to every-design design practise.
3. Designers learn from project work and
evolving experience. Whilst there are numerous academic publications
in the field of eco-design, these are invariably not accessed
by designers, who adopt a "hands on" practical approach
in learning and skills development.
4. The research concluded that SME design
consultancies feel they are small fry in ability to implement
eco-design and waste-minimalisation strategies, due to their clientsoften
large organisationsenforcing time and cost restrictions
on the small enterprises they outsource design work to.
5. Design consultancies often state that
the only way to ensure that design for environment strategies
are enforced is through more concise, practical legislation, that
can integrated into the design process.
6. In the current UK design sectors, designers
state they lack informationbe it knowledge about environmentally-preferable
materials, eco-design strategies or general business support initiatives.
7. The evidence concludes with a need for
a higher level of innovation within the design industry. Rather
than slowly making incremental changes in developing products
and services that are marginally less environmentally-less damaging,
designers need assistance in becoming better at innovation. The
innovation of new products and service systems has the potential
to change consumer behaviour and move more quickly towards a sustainable
society.
BACKGROUND
8. De Montfort University's Faculty of Art
and Design is distinguished in producing industry-relevant design
education. Engaging with the industry that the faculty feeds is
fundamental to achieving this capability. A strong component of
this collaboration is dmudesigna design consultancy based
within the University that also works in supporting and developing
the design and manufacturing industry within the East Midlands
region.
9. Beginning with Improving Business
by Design in 2003, dmudesign has been charged with
enabling SMEs to develop their businesses through innovative product
design by both Leicestershire Economic Partnership and the East
Midlands Development Agency. The focus throughout all programmes
has been identifying opportunities for innovation within the East
Midlands' design and manufacturing sector.
10. Our most recent programme, The Resource
Efficient Design (RED) Initiative assists businesses in minimising
the negative environmental impact of their products as well as
identifying opportunities for innovation that can have a significant
impact on resource efficiency. The key focus of The RED Initiative
is to demonstrate the opportunities that resource-efficient design
can deliver for businesses.
11. The RED Initiative works with the commercial
interior design and industrial design sectors. 93 per cent of
product and industrial design consultancies in the UK are SMEs,
of which 82 per cent have less than 10 employees. 98 per cent
of interior and exhibition design companies in the UK are SMEs
of which 94 per cent have less than 10 employees. Collectively,
the UK's design consultancies have a large influence over the
environmental impact of products in the UK and with 16 per cent
of SME design consultancies having overseas clients, this impact
stretches worldwide.
12. The following evidence outlines the
experiences of dmudesign programmes in relation to eco-design
practice in SME design consultancies in the East Midlands.
Can better designed products offset the increase
in consumption?
Yes
13. It is widely recognised amongst eco-design
practitioners that over 80 per cent of all product-related environmental
impacts are determined during the design phase. In any given product
this can include environmental damage in sourcing materials, emissions
and waste in production and wasted energy in use, in addition
to the environmental impacts of disposal.
14. Eco-design can assist in waste reduction
through minimising the use of materials or selecting alternative
materials, however, design has a pivotal and potentially more
critical role to play in changing consumption patterns. In order
to achieve a sustainable society it is critical that alternative
lifestyle solutions are designed, developed and adopted.
15. The various levels of eco-design implementation
can be broadly grouped into two levels: development and innovation.
The development of existing products can lead to a reduction in
their impact. The innovation of products and services has the
potential to adapt consumer behaviour and move more quickly towards
an environmental and social equilibrium.
How can better product design be used to effect
a change in consumption patterns and behaviour?
16. The role of the designer differs from
the engineer in the focus on human interface. "Human-factors"
is a core skill of the design discipline. The designer is therefore
well placed to understand, interpret and influence the consumption
patterns and lifestyles of consumers.
17. A simple example of an innovative environmentally-preferable
solution is the eco-kettle. The designers recognised that the
major environmental impact throughout the life-cycle of a kettle
is the excessive energy use due to users over-filling the product.
The solution: a kettle that boils the required amount of water
and reserves the remaining water for subsequent uses. The Department
of Environment, Food and Rural Affairs say that "If everyone
boiled only the water they needed instead of `filling' the kettle
every time, we could save enough electricity to run practically
all the street lighting in the UK".[29]
18. An example of "forward thinking"
by eco-innovators can be found in transportation. As opposed to
the minimal reductions that can be made through reducing materials
in production (such as the SMART car) or reducing the energy in
use (for example the Toyota Prius), a significantly greater environmental
benefit can be gained from vehicle sharing schemes. One such scheme
is the UCR Intellishare project[30]
where users select vehicles that suit their needs for each individual
transportation requirement only when they are needed.
What role can better design play in minimising
the creation of waste?
19. At a more superficial level designers
can develop products with waste minimisation in mind. Where affecting
consumption patterns is not possible, designers can use various
strategies to minimise the creation of waste.
20. There are various strategies for waste
reduction including:
(i) design for disassembly;
(iii) design for durability;
(vi) life cycle/Cradle to Cradle design.
21. The initial reaction to minimising waste
is often to focus on the end of a product's life cycle; however,
the major impacts of a product may be elsewhere.
22. In energy-using products the highest
environmental impact is typically the use stage. In this case
efforts should be focused on energy reduction in use. An interesting
example of this is Procter and Gamble's latest campaign, initiated
in conjunction with Forum for the Future, that encourages
their washing product users to turn their washing machines from
40 to 30 degrees.
Eco-design practice within industrial and commercial
interior design consultancies
23. The RED Initiative supports the concept
that the most effective way to progress design towards sustainability
is to focus on the opportunities for innovation. Unfortunately
the present focus of most organisations is on incremental improvement
and redesign of existing products. There was found to be limited
understanding of the opportunities that eco-design can bring for
both design consultants and their clients.
THE USE
OF MATERIALS
Challenges facing designers in adopting eco-design
in everyday design practice.
Material selection
24. The experience of The RED Initiative
is that the main eco-design strategy that designers focus on is
materials selection. This is supported by their clients who, where
eco-design issues are considered, are reported to focus their
requests for consideration of material selection.
25. Material selection amongst designers
is normally experience-based. The majority of products will be
designed in relation to their predecessors or similar products.
26. Designers indicated that the main barrier
to selection of environmentally-preferable materials is a perceived
additional cost. This is combined with a lack of confidence in
the quality and performance of eco-materials, as they are often
perceived as inferior alternatives.
Materials availability
27. The RED Initiative has experienced limited
application of alternative materials (such as biopolymers and
smart materials) by SME designers due to the potential limited
availability in sourcing such materials. However, designers often
mention materials featuring a high recycled content when considering
eco-design alternatives.
28. One area in which material scarcity
is regularly considered is when selecting Forestry Stewardship
Council (FSC)-approved wood based products. The labelling scheme
is well-known and commercial interiors designers often specify
FSC-approved woods.
29. In most cases however, the selection
of environmentally-preferable materials based on material availability
is limited, with the majority of enquiries based on the selection
of materials that have the appearance of "environmental friendliness".
End of life impacts of raw materials
30. Information on the potential end-of-life
routes for products is not well understood by designers. This
reflects the disparate recycling systems that products may face
both within the UK and abroad. Apart from reuse, opportunities
for product disassembly or even recycling of many products are
limited. This lack of coherent systems restricts the potential
for development of products in relation to end of life strategies.
31. There is potential for the development
of more sophisticated and consistent recycling systems as legislation
such as Waste Electronic and Electrical Equipment regulations
(WEEE) bring a larger quantity of materials together.
What impact does the development of new materials
have on design?
32. The development of new materials has
limited impact on "everyday design" due to the need
for materials to be proved and costs and supply chain issues to
be reduced and resolved.
33. With limited time and money for product
development, designers indicate that they are rarely given the
opportunity to experiment with alternative materials. Where they
do try alternative materials it is likely to be in conjunction
with a manufacturer, who will be more knowledgeable about the
behaviour of that material in production.
34. In general, designers are more interested
in which of the conventional, readily available materials are
the least damaging. Constraints of time and demands on producing
workable outcomes with limited testing often prevent even this
level of alternative materials selection.
35. Where designers are looking to select
an alternative material, they often remark that they find it difficult
to select alternatives due to the lack of information about environmental
benefits. Designers want a "quick fix" solution due
to limited time for a full study of the material options. Providing
information that simplistically ranks materials can be misleading,
as environmental superiority is often situation specific. Further
understanding and time to consider the overall lifecycle impacts
of materials is required.
DEMAND (BUSINESS
FRAMEWORK)
How central is sustainable design to business
thinking?
36. Amongst SME design consultancies, their
directors and their staff, there is a general desire to respond
to environmental concerns in their business practice, and in the
design and production of products. Unfortunately this desire is
not met by a tangible/financial demand. Eco-design practice is
limited, with most small organisations rarely including eco-design
considerations.
37. Even (as is often the case) when SME
design consultancies and manufacturers produce work for larger
organisations, there is little to no legal requirement for eco-design
considerations.
38. Currently, resource-efficient design
is viewed as a specialist or retrospective discipline. Enterprises
of all sizes tend to only actively apply strategies of eco-design
when they perceive that there are benefits to be gained from "green
marketing" resulting from the applied eco-design.
39. However, a perceived fear of being left
behind other enterprises who may already be implementing approaches
is starting to alert businesses to the need to take action. According
to Paaru Chauhan-Pancholi from retail design consultancy Briggs
Hillier Design LTD, SMEs can not afford to lose clients if they
can not prove their knowledge about sustainability issues.
40. Where businesses genuinely do wish to
implement sustainable design strategies into their everyday business
practice, they are often ill-informed about the methodology of
establishing such strategies and find it difficult to identify
good starting points for eco-innovation.
What initiatives are in place to encourage this
and are they meeting business needs?
41. There are number of national government-funded
environmental support programmes made available to businesses,
such as The Carbon Trust, Business Link and Envirowise, as well
as a host of regional development agency-funded local organisations
open to SMEsfor example The RED Initiative, The BEST Network,
and Carbon Action Yorkshire.
42. When consulting with SME design groups
about the value of both local government programmes and national
environmental-support programmes in assisting businesses in improving
their environmental performance, it was discovered that SMEs found
regional business-support units more accessible and effective
in conveying practical advice. Design SMEs particularly found
programmes such as The RED Initiative to be of high value, due
to the programme offering services specifically focused on the
design industry, allowing support tailored to the precise needs
of the SME to be communicated to businesses.[31]
However, most design SMEs still feel that more engagement is needed
between businesses and environmental- and business support organisations.
43. It is the view of many SMEs that the
Design Council is currently very London-centric and should be
more proactive in disseminating information, training and research
conclusions into the design industry. According to Associate Director
Kate Shepard from retail design and branding agency Checkland
Kindleysides,
"The Design Council should play a larger
and more significant part in informing design businesses about
legislation and incorporating sustainability into SMEs' every
day practise".
44. The Design Council-run programme Design
of The Times (DOTT) and Designing Demand is already attempting
to fulfil this need, although here there is less of a focus on
eco design. Instead the project appears to consider general sustainability
and cultural innovation issues, rather than directly engaging
with design groups to assist them in employing practical eco-design
techniques.
Does the current policy, regulatory and legal
framework support incentivise the development of better, more
sustainable products and processes? How is the framework communicated
to businesses and what is the level of awareness and understanding
among businesses?
45. There are national organisations such
as the Design Business Association (DBA) and The British Design
Innovation (BDI) offering services to design businesses such as
information on legislation, legal advice and training packages.
However, research carried out by The Design Council concluded
that "architects are more than twice as likely as designers
to be doing job-related training" and "the proportion
of people engaged in job related training is far lower among designers
than for all other similar occupational groups".[32]
There is therefore a need to communicate with design consultancies
and in-house designers the need and benefits of continual training
and skills development of employees, and to create stronger links
between design businesses and organisations offering training
services.
46. Other creative industries such as architecture
and engineering have governing bodies such as the Royal Institute
of British Architects (RIBA) and the Institution of Mechanical
Engineers (ImechE) that oversee and regulate practitioners. These
bodies offer an acreditation service where the members become
Chartered or professionally qualified to work in the sector, and
which is recognised by both the industry and their clients. In
contrast, the governing body for the design industry is The Design
Council; however, this is not seen by designers or the larger
organisations that they produce work for as being regulatory or
having any real control in implementing legislation. Similarly,
The Charted Society of Designers, Royal Society of Arts and the
Institute of Engineering Designers are less well recognised in
the industry than RIBA, for example.
47. There is therefore a need for a more
recognised regulatory body in the design industry, to ensure strategies
such as eco-design are successfully implemented in businesses.
48. The Design Skills Advisory Panel document,
Higher Skills For Higher Value, written by the Sector Skills
Council, Creative and Cultural Skills and The Design Council highlights
an urgent need for more continual professional development in
the design industry with regard to sustainability in design. It
proposes that this should be a priority for the National Design
Academy proposal in its report; however, progress on this recommendation
has yet to come into fruition.
DESIGN INDUSTRY
NEEDS
What are the gaps in knowledge and how are they
being addressed?
49. There is a need to provide in-depth
support in Resource Efficient Design throughout the design cycle,
where actual environmentally-considered, commercial products are
generated. In addition, resource efficient design must be mainstreamed
into the various sectors of the design industry whilst providing
a step change in skills and accelerated development of environmental
products and services.
50. At present, design consultancies and
manufacturers' in-house designers have little awareness of eco-design
approaches. The current perception of most designers is that products
and services can be designed from an environmental approach simply
by using eco-preferable materials. There is very little understanding
of what life-cycle design methodology entails, nor how to apply
it.
51. SME Designers often state they have
little time to research traditional academic sources on subjects
such as eco-design strategies; instead they invariably prefer
to adopt practical, "hands-on" approaches to design.
52. Designers learn from experience, and
so often an effective way of learning new skills and applying
new approaches to design is through establishing exploratory design
projects that allow true innovation and creativity, and that are
not bound by the needs and demands of a client. For example, Creative
id*a ltd are in the process of generating a showcase sustainable
point of sale stand, to develop their designers' understanding
and capabilities in the field of eco-design and to demonstrate
to their clients the opportunities of eco-innovation within a
commercial environment.
53. With regard to environmentally-preferable
materials for use within 3D design, designers for the most part
know of few specific examples of such materials, and also have
little understanding about what different factors make one material
more environmentally-preferable than another. There is therefore
a need for more communication between materials scientists, materials
suppliers and designers, and collaboration on development "showcase"
projects where new materials can be utilised.
Impact of legislation
54. Legislation such as WEEE and Packaging
(Essential Requirements) Regulations rarely influence the design
practice of designers in consultancies. The legislation is normally
dealt with in a reactive way making it of limited use in influencing
designers' mentalities to waste minimisation. An example of the
types of barriers faced can be seen in the WEEE legislation. The
WEEE Directive will cause an inherent cost to manufacturers but
this will generally be accepted as an unavoidable, additional
cost. It does not encourage designers to find alternative materials
or design solutions.
55. Soft requirements that are often included
in regulations, such as "|packaging shall be manufactured
that the packaging volume and weight be limited..."[33]
have limited effect on moving the industry.
56. In light of this difficulty, "The
Government wants the European Commission to reform the Packaging
(Essential Requirements) Regulations, saying criteria such as
`consumer acceptance' make the laws difficult to enforce..."[34]
57. Some retail design consultancies are
trying to establish take-back systems but these need to be joined-up
with the retailers and should ideally be driven by their customers.
The need for legislation
58. There are requests from certain sectors
to legislate against specific materials and practices. For example,
the retail design industry, a highly competitive, high turnover,
highly wasteful sector sees legislation as the necessary driving
force for their industry to change its current practice.
59. However, The RED Initiative has seen
that there are opportunities for the industry to develop towards
more sustainable solutions, in a more productive and rewarding
way.
60. For example, Sheridan and Coan
established retail design consultancyare producing a showcase,
eco-design concept solution, to market the opportunities for resource
efficient design. They are exploring alternative materials as
well as innovation in the design. DIAM UK (part of a larger international
organisation) has been trying to develop a system to return their
display units for recycling and appropriate disposal.
61. When asking SMEs their opinions about
the effectiveness of current and new legislation from an environmental
improvement perspective, Paaru Chauhan-Pancholi from Briggs Hillier
Design replied:
"There is a need for more legislation to
force design groups and their clients to apply eco-design strategies,
as the issues and need for sustainability, plus the methods and
technologies to deal with the problems are already in existence.
However, the government needs to bear in mind the practicalities
of implementing eco-design legislation in businesses, such as
the cost implications, and availability and communications about
eco-materials and systems in the supply chain".
62. Any new legislation should ensure that
resource efficient design (eco-design) is a mainstream, normal,
accepted principle in every day design practice, not just a specialist
or retrospective application.
63. Existing legislation is of limited value.
Encouraging solutions to definable problems does not stimulate
the creativity that designers can bring in providing innovative,
radical solutions. For example, defining a requirement for materials
reduction does not encourage the use of alternative materials.
Demanding use of biodegradable materials, for example, may restrict
the development of a more durable, reusable solution.
64. Need to stimulate demand amongst consumers,
demonstrate the opportunities to businesses, support SMEs, legislate
where possible to abolish the worst and encourage development
of eco-designed products.
65. Legislation needs to include systems
considerations, for example, the requirements on designers to
improve recyclability must be met by improved recycling systems.
A momentum is needed in the demonstration of functional and saleable
materials' properties in order for them to be taken up by the
design industry.
CONCLUSIONS
66. The ideal scenario is for eco-design
to be incorporated as a natural part of the everyday design process.
To designers, good design should mean that eco-design considerations
are an integral factor.
67. Designers are not typically in control
of what they design. Generally designers operate in very small
businesses that sell skills to large corporations, who generally
undervalue design.
68. The creative capability of the UK's
design industry is not lacking, nor is its desire to reduce the
environmental impact of product and retail design. As an industry
dominated by small businesses, its ability to drive change in
this area is limited as it relies heavily on clients for day to
day turnover of business. Conversely, SME design consultancies
have an invaluable capacity for innovation. Organisations that
contract designers must recognise the value of design in order
to produce design solutions that are exceptional in all aspects,
including their environmental impact.
69. A level of momentum should be expected
from the design industry as it must demonstrate the opportunities
to clients. Some design consultancies are taking the lead and
differentiating themselves. Some designers have remarked on the
need for designers to be proactive in demonstrating the potential
of eco-design.
70. "Try to promote the advantages
of eco design to our clients and focus their minds on the advantages
it can bring to their business."[35]
71. Design in the UK is at risk from the
development of the cheaper overseas market.[36]
Value added services are an opportunity for UK consultancies to
maintain a cutting edge.
"...Accepting that resource-efficient design
or eco-design is becoming part of the design & manufacturing
landscape, design consultancies have to be proactive and include
it as part of their package of research, design & development
servicesnot least because it is adding value to their own
consultancy work as well as to that of their clients. Only a short-termist
could argue otherwise."[37]
72. There is a need to enable SMEs to keep
abreast of environmental requirements and industry trends. Larger
organisations have the time to invest in developing their knowledge
and strategies in this area. However the overwhelming trend to
outsource design means that these skills are not developed within
the design function of the product development process. Environmental
considerations in relation to products or environments tend to
stay within company policy and corporate and social responsibility
(CSR) reports, rather than being implemented as the design function.
73. It is important that the value of the
SME design industry is recognised and supported in developing
invaluable eco-design skills and knowledge.
